Westminster Winter Park, an upscale Active Living Community, has a full time position open for a Certified Chef to be a part of our progressive service oriented team. We are looking for an individual with independent living experience, supervisory skills, including the ability to plan, direct & execute exciting & stimulating dining experiences for our residents. POSITION SUMMARY:
Assists the Director of Dining in the planning, coordinating and implementation of the quality dining program for resident’s staff and guests. Oversees the culinary component, HAACP program and Sanitation program of the dining program in all of the food production and service areas within the community. Provides support in assigned areas during the absence of the Director of Dining Services. Expanded distinct duties may be attached to this document.
ESSENTIAL POSITION FUNCTIONS:
Comply with all applicable rules, policies, standards and guidelines related to employment with Westminster Communities.
Expanded distinct duties may be attached to this document.
1. Manage the entire operations of the kitchen(s).
2. Oversee the purchase of food, food supplies and equipment. Adheres to specific budget objectives.
3. Supervise meal preparation, presentation and quality by following accurate reproduction of recipes by cooks and prep staff.
4. Perform food inventory and/or place orders as required.
5. Ensures that training, safety and discipline standards are met.
6. Responsible for kitchen staff compliance with sanitation and food safety standards
